Title: The Clockmaker’s Apprentice

In a small town by the sea, there was a clockmaker who could repair any
timepiece, no matter how broken. People whispered that he didn’t just fix
clocks — he could fix time itself. His apprentice, a curious boy named Elias,
wanted to learn this secret.

One night, Elias discovered a hidden drawer beneath the workbench. Inside,
there was a clock with no hands and no numbers, only a single golden gear
that pulsed like a heartbeat. When Elias touched it, the workshop dissolved,
and he found himself reliving the happiest memory of his childhood.

The clockmaker entered and placed a hand on his shoulder.


“Every broken clock remembers a moment,” he said. “The question is, do
you want to fix it, or keep it broken?”

Elias never looked at time the same way again.
